What Does AGI Really Mean?

AGI, or Artificial General Intelligence, refers to a type of AI that can perform any intellectual task a human can do. Unlike narrow AI—which is designed to complete specific tasks like language translation, image recognition, or driving a car—AGI has the flexibility and adaptability of the human mind.

It can reason, plan, solve novel problems, learn from minimal data, transfer knowledge across domains, and even reflect on its own thoughts. In essence, AGI is the next step in the evolution of artificial intelligence, and it promises to break free from the limitations of task-specific models.

AGI will not need to be fine-tuned for every single job. Instead, it will adapt like a human, figuring out how to approach tasks on its own, even those it has never encountered before.


The Core Capabilities of AGI

To achieve general intelligence, an AI system must demonstrate the following:

  • Abstract Reasoning: Understand complex concepts and apply them in multiple contexts.
  • Memory & Recall: Store and retrieve information like human memory.
  • Self-Learning: Improve through experience without retraining.
  • Emotional Understanding: Recognize and respond to emotional cues.
  • Autonomous Decision-Making: Set goals, evaluate outcomes, and iterate plans.
  • Multi-modal Perception: Interpret visual, auditory, linguistic, and environmental inputs simultaneously.

These qualities together make AGI more than just an algorithm—it becomes an agent capable of real-world engagement.


Where Are We Now in 2025?

While true AGI hasn’t been fully realized, we’re getting closer with each iteration of large AI models. Systems like OpenAI’s GPT-5, Anthropic’s Claude, and Google’s Gemini are showing signs of:

  • Emergent reasoning capabilities
  • Multi-modal input processing (text + image + audio)
  • Memory and personalization
  • Contextual understanding over long conversations

These advancements lay the groundwork for AGI. Additionally, autonomous agents (AI that can act on goals in digital environments) and robotics integration further push us toward AGI-enabled machines.
